Porch raising services involve the careful lifting and support of an existing porch or deck to address structural issues or prepare for repairs.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ment to elevate the structure safely, allowing for necessary work on the foundation, supports, or framing. This process helps ensure the porch remains stable and secure, preventing further damage or safety hazards. It is often a practical solution when a porch has settled, shifted, or become uneven over time, making it unsafe or unusable.
This service is particularly helpful for resolving problems caused by shifting soil, aging materials, or poor initial construction. A sagging or unstable porch can pose safety risks to residents and visitors, especially when the structure begins to wobble or show signs of deterioration. Raising the porch can also create a level surface that improves accessibility and usability, making it easier to enjoy outdoor spaces. Homeowners facing issues like cracked stairs, uneven flooring, or leaning supports may find porch raising to be an effective way to restore safety and functionality.
Properties that typically benefit from porch raising include older homes with foundations that have settled, as well as homes built on uneven or shifting ground. The overview below groups typical Porch Raising proj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Grand Forks, ND.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Many porch raising projects for minor adjustments typically cost between $250 and $600. These jobs often involve lifting and stabilizing a porch that has settled slightly over time. Most routine repairs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ching higher costs.
Moderate Elevations - For more significant height adjustments or partial replacements of porch supports, costs generally range from $600 to $1,500. These projects may include replacing joists or posts and are common for homes experiencing moderate settling issues.
Full Porch Lifts - Complete porch raising or leveling for larger structures can range from $1,500 to $3,500. These jobs often involve multiple support points and more extensive work to ensure stability across the entire porch area.
Full Replacement - In cases where the existing porch foundation is severely compromised, full replacement costs typically start around $4,000 and can exceed $8,000. Larger, more complex projects are less common but necessary for significant structural concerns.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
